J'ai VMware Workstation exécuté sur un hôte Ubuntu avec un invité Ubuntu. Est-il possible d'accéder directement au GPU depuis la VM?
Je veux exécuter CUDA sur la VM
J'ai VMware Workstation exécuté sur un hôte Ubuntu avec un invité Ubuntu. Est-il possible d'accéder directement au GPU depuis la VM?
Je veux exécuter CUDA sur la VM
Réponses:
Ce n'est pas le cas à moins que nVidia ne fournisse un pilote paravirtualisé compatible avec VMware à cet effet.
Cette discussion sur les forums nVidia explique pourquoi.
Désormais, les nouveaux processeurs et chipsets prennent en charge "IOMMU", qui pourrait servir la fonction similaire à "passthrough PCI-E" dont ils discutent sur ce forum. Cependant, cela nécessite toujours le support et la coopération des pilotes paravirtualisés de VMware et des pilotes de nVidia, qui n'existe pas encore.
Si vous êtes prêt à utiliser Xen au lieu de VMware Workstation, vous pouvez essayer Xen VGA Passthrough et voir si votre configuration matérielle est prise en charge. Cela vous donnerait un contrôle total sur la carte graphique de la machine virtuelle.
Voici un exemple de ce que vous pouvez accomplir: http://www.youtube.com/watch?v=Gtmwnx-k2qg